Mortgage 101-Rental History

 

Author: Steve Salzman

Every American teen dreams of the day he/she will leave their parents home and rent their first apartment. What a wonderful time it will be. Independence. There is no one to boss you around. Most people dont plan for the future. Are you thinking a purchasing your first home? Are you currently renting an apartment? How are you paying? Check, Cash, or Money order?

The reality is that lenders for first time homebuyers want to see a 12 to 24 month rental history. If youre renting from an apartment complex that has a management company onsite then lenders will accept their word. What happens if youre renting from a private person that owns a couple of properties and is managing it themselves? The lender will want to see canceled checks for the last 12 to 24 months. The reason for this is to see if you can pay on time. If your checks were dated before the rent was due then youre a good candidate to pay your mortgage on time. But if you have inconsistencies in your rent payments the underwriter will have to make a decision based on certain guidelines.

Underwriters are paid by the lender to ensure that the borrower will have the ability to pay the mortgage. If you dont fit into their guidelines then you will not be able to obtain a mortgage. Are all lenders guidelines the same? No they are not. That is why it is better to go to mortgage broker than to a bank when getting a mortgage. Mortgage Brokers have many different lenders with different guideline criteria. One lender may accept a private Verification of Rent when another lender will not. Also, many mortgage brokers will know what lender that has less stringent guidelines over another.

So when considering purchasing a home make sure you have canceled checks proving your ability to pay rent on time. Cash and money orders will not be sufficient because those forms of payment cant be proven like canceled checks.
